What companies run services between King's Cross Station, England and Reading, England?

Great Western Railway (GWR) operates a train from London Paddington to Reading every 10 minutes. Tickets cost £16–30 and the journey takes 38 min. Elizabeth Line (TfL) also services this route every 3 hours.
